Voters approve change to NY Constitution on ‘clean’ environment, reject proposals on elections
New York state's voters have rejected proposals for same-day voter registration and no-excuse absentee ballots, but approved an amendment on the environment. Voters in New York appeared to reject three amendments to the state constitution on Tuesday that would have modified the state’s redistricting process and made it easier to vote, while approving two others on the environment and courts in New York City.…
